Thursday, 13th February 2025
Around 200 eager buyers viewed new show homes in Rossett on the first day.
Castle Green Homes welcomed a steady stream of visitors to Trevalyn Place during the launch weekend.
The event was attended by those who’ve already reserved and are waiting for their new homes to be built, plus prospective purchasers including existing homeowners with a property to sell before they can commit to buying.
Castle Green Homes sales director Sian Pitt said: “We knew from the volume of enquiries we’d received about our new homes in Rossett that demand for housing in the area is high. It was great to see so many people visit the show homes at the earliest opportunity. At some points during the launch, people were waiting for others to leave a room or a house so that they could look around. Feedback is they loved being able to experience some of the different layouts and specification choices we offer.
“We’re working with a number of potential purchasers who are keen to move here. Some have a house they need to sell first, and we can help with that with Easy Move or part exchange. Others could benefit from some financial support, and we can offer a contribution towards the Land Transaction Tax or stamp duty as it’s more commonly known. We can tailor the incentive to the individual’s needs.”
The show homes are examples of the three-bedroom detached Evesham and four-bedroom detached Salisbury and Ashbourne house types. The sales team will be based in a four-bedroom Heatherington, equipped with state-of-the-art CGI technology.
Current availability at Trevalyn Place includes a choice of three and four-bedroom homes, priced from £334,995.
A four-bedroom detached Cambridge will be ready to move into this spring. It’s priced from £689,995, with Castle Green offering a contribution towards the stamp duty.
The Cambridge features an inviting lounge with bay window at the front of the property, with a combined kitchen, dining and family room spanning the rear. There’s also a utility and cloakroom.
Upstairs, there are two en-suite bedrooms, with the main bedroom also boasting a dressing room. The family bathroom effectively serves the other two bedrooms.
Situated on Rossett Road, the location has broad appeal.
“Rossett is a lovely village, with a strong sense of community,” Sian added. “There are shops, pubs and restaurants, plus outstanding locals nearby. Both Chester and Wrexham are only around 15 minutes’ drive away, giving residents the chance to embrace rural village living with easy access to the amenities of the two cities. It’s no surprise that the homes in Rossett are attracting those already living in or close to the village and those looking to relocate for a change in their pace and quality of life.”
